The Professional Certificate in STEM Literacy for Young Learners is a critical qualification in today’s market, addressing the growing demand for STEM skills in the UK. According to recent data, 75% of UK employers report difficulties in recruiting workers with advanced STEM skills, while 89% of STEM businesses face skills shortages. This certificate equips educators and professionals with the tools to foster STEM literacy in young learners, preparing them for future careers in science, technology, engineering, and mathematics. The UK government has identified STEM as a priority sector, with £7 billion invested annually in STEM education and research. Additionally, 72% of UK employers believe that early STEM education is essential for addressing the skills gap.
